  • The Jobs Guarantee

    The Jobs Guarantee will provide a fully subsidised six-month paid job to eligible 18–21 year olds who have been on Universal Credit and looking for work for 18 months. Through the scheme, the government will fund 100% of eligible employment costs for 25 hours a week at the relevant minimum wage, alongside wrap-around support to help participants succeed on the scheme and transition into sustained employment. Beginning with Phase One from Spring 2026, the Department for Work and Pensions will award grants to selected delivery organisations in the following areas: Birmingham & Solihull, East Midlands, Greater Manchester, Hertfordshire & Essex, Central & East Scotland, Southwest & Southeast Wales.
